About The Position

The Legal Entity Accounting Controllership team is a critical part of Antares that leads the preparation, review, and delivery of financial statements and regulatory filings across monthly, quarterly, and annual cycles. The SVP of Legal Entity Accounting drives transformation and mentors a high-performing team. Our ideal candidate is independent, motivated, detail‐oriented and able to analyze data and convey conclusions effectively.

Responsibilities

  • Prepare and review mon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ements, including MD&A
  • Manage monthly financial close and intercompany eliminations
  • Ensure all entries are booked to the correct legal entities in accordance with Investment Advisory agreements and as expected in budget
  • Review key transactions during months & quarters with the business to ensure recorded correctly
  • Liaise with external auditors; ensure all reviews and audits are completed timely
  • Prepare monthly internal management schedules (e.g., assets under management)
  • Ensure compliance with statutory reporting and filing
  • Own and maintain dimensionality in OneStream and DFIN
  • Support legal and capital solutions teams with unsecured offerings. Manage all deliverables needed from financial perspective
  • Maintain a strong internal control framework
  • Evaluate and improve financial processes
  • Manage, mentor, and develop the financial reporting and general ledger booking team
  • Collaborate with FP&A, Treasury, Tax, Operations, and Investor Reporting
  • Contribute to transformation projects
  • Manage approval process around financial data included in key external presentations from Investor Relations and Marketing
